Students learned about Easter traditions and made their first Easter eggs.

Easter is one of the most joyous festivals of the year, marked by the arrival of spring, and hence one of the most popular social gatherings for international students. On 11 April, the students were treated to a wonderful presentation in the dorms, during which they learned about several Czech Easter customs and traditions and did not go home empty-handed. A record number of students from a variety of nations, including Greece, Spain, Turkey, Morocco, India, and Bangladesh, attended this year's Easter celebrations. 

A joint meeting of representatives of the International Relations Office, international students, and the Buddy Team was held in the student dormitories at Vyhlídka, where refreshments, and gifts were provided, and, last but not least, the students were introduced to Easter decorations such as a braided whip made from pussy-willow twigs, lambs, and Easter eggs, which they also decorated themselves using wax techniques and could take away a handmade souvenir. We believe that the students left with not only interesting knowledge and their own products but also pleasant memories of this year's Easter, which they will recall thanks to the photos.
